Streetcar Shooting Of Sammy Yatim By Police Officer Draws Protests [Video]


The streetcar shooting of the teenage Sammy Yatim by a police officer has generated protests numbering hundreds of people.

The streetcar shooting doesn’t involve fake cops. Nor was it a fake knife that Sammy Yatim was wielding. But when the teen pulled the knife in a streetcar the passengers emptied out and the police came in. When Sammy Yatim wouldn’t put down his knife the police officer demanded, “If you take one step in this direction with that foot, [inaudible] die.” Sammy Yatim apparently didn’t listen and in response he was shot nine times in 13 seconds by the police officer. Even after being shot, other police officers tasered Sammy Yatim while he was on the ground.

Some people are saying the cop overreacted and that the taser should have been used first. Others point out they could have prevented the streetcar shooting by potentially talking Sammy Yatim down.

The streetcar shooting upset people to the point the police officer was suspended with pay while the streetcar shooting was investigated. The police officer suspended for the streetcar shooting is said to be “devastated” and overwhelmed. Toronto police chief Bill Blair calls the streetcar shooting tragic:

“I am aware of the very serious concerns the public has. I know that people are seeking answers as to what occurred, why it happened and if anything could have been done to prevent the tragic death of this young man. I am also seeking answers to these important questions.”

Hundreds gathered in Toronto for a streetcar shooting protest. They chanted slogans like “we want justice” while carrying placards and wearing T-shirts.
